Общение между гаджетами OpenSocial через gadgets.rpc - PullRequest
0 голосов
/ 20 ноября 2010

Могу ли я иметь пример связи между двумя гаджетами OpenSocial с помощью API gadgets.rpc ?

Я искал один, но самый близкий, который я могу найти, является устаревшим примеромгаджета к контейнеру связи.

1 Ответ

0 голосов
/ 14 декабря 2010

вы можете использовать pubsub для связи между гаджетами.

на гаджете вы подписываетесь на событие следующим образом:

gadgets.pubsub.subscribe("my_event_type",whenEventHappens);
function whenEventHappens(sender, message){
      alert(message.content);
}

на другом гаджете вы публикуете события следующим образом:

var message = {};
message["content"] = "hey,wassup?";
gadgets.pubsub.publish("my_event_type", message);
...